Restaurant operators in Mesquite, Texas, can secure Equipment Financing to acquire essential assets like ovens, walk-ins, fryers, POS systems, and delivery vehicles. This program helps fund crucial restaurant equipment without depleting cash reserves. Funds range from 5,000 to 500,000, with terms spanning 24 to 84 months. Funding typically occurs within 1 to 5 business days, with fixed monthly payments.

Equipment Financing Structure and Benefits

Equipment Financing offers a clear cost structure with fixed monthly payments, simplifying financial planning for Mesquite restaurant owners. This predictability allows businesses to budget accurately and understand their repayment obligations upfront. Terms for this program range from 24 to 84 months, providing flexibility to align payments with the expected lifespan and revenue generation of the acquired equipment.

The process for Equipment Financing is straightforward: after an application, an equipment quote, and bank statements are provided, funding can occur quickly. This efficiency is critical for restaurants needing to replace a broken piece of equipment or capitalize on a time-sensitive opportunity. This program focuses solely on equipment acquisition, distinct from working capital or other financing types, ensuring capital is specifically deployed for tangible assets.

Your Equipment Financing Referral Process

Foody Finance serves as an independent business financing referral service, connecting Mesquite restaurants with independent funding partners for Equipment Financing. We publish and explain financing information for US food service businesses. The process begins with a free specialist review, which involves no credit application or hard credit pull. This initial conversation helps qualify the inquiry based on state, product class, and basic facts.

After this review, we refer your qualified inquiry to our funding partners. One or more partners may then contact you directly. You will proceed with a program-specific application, which may lead to written offers. You then choose the offer that best fits your needs, or you walk away. Foody Finance never quotes rates or terms, compares offers, negotiates, or prepares applications. Every offer, rate, term, and state disclosure comes directly from the funding partner.
